 Encampment of the Eufaula Rifles
Description: The Encampment of the Eufaula Rifles is held each year during the Eufaula Heritage Association Pilgrimage. The encampment is a living history experience of how citizen soldiers existed in camps during the beginning of the Civil War in Alabama. Students and adults dress in period uniforms, demonstrate cooking activities, live in reproductions of tents of the era, and demonstrate training exercises and the type of guns used during the period. Cannon firings on the hour create a lot of excitement in the encampment. The encampment is held on the grounds of Fendall Hall. Visits to the encampment are free, a tour of Fendall Hall requires a ticket from the Pilgrimage Association or paid admission at the door.

 Yatta Abba Day
Description: 334-432-3600. cityofabbeville.org. Free. Downtown--Area artists, garden enthusiasts, gospel, bluegrass and oldies music, antique cars, a cemetery tour and skit, food vendors including everything from fried cornbread and turnip greens to corn dogs and funnel cakes. Local actors also perform a reenactment of the famous dead in the Old Abbeville Cemetery. Street dance on Friday night prior to festival from 6-9 p.m. Other activities, Sat., 9 a.m. until.
